On March 7, Saskatchewan launched the new Tech Talent Pathway under the Saskatchewan Immigrant Nominee Program (SINP) to attract tech workers into the province. The Tech Talent Pathway is intended to ease critical labour shortages in Saskatchewan’s tech sector. Immigration minister announces new measure to finalize caregiver applications for permanent residence. Canada’s immigration department plans to finalize 6,000 caregiver applications for permanent residence by December 31, 2021. Ontario nominated a total of 15,303 new immigrants through its PNP last year. Despite the pandemic, Ontario still nominated high numbers of new immigrants in 2020. Through the Ontario Immigrant Nominee Program (OINP), Ontario nominated 8,054 principal applicants in 2020, who came with their spouses and children for a total of 15,303 nominations.
